> For the complete documentation index, see [llms.txt](https://ajuda.cardapioweb.com/llms.txt). Markdown versions of documentation pages are available by appending `.md` to page URLs; this page is available as [Markdown](https://ajuda.cardapioweb.com/gestao/catalogo/como-criar-um-produto-e-uma-categoria/como-criar-um-produto-com-variacoes-de-valores-a-partir-de.md).

# Como criar um produto com variações de valores (a partir de)

Para cadastrar um produto com preço inicial **"a partir de"**, siga os passos abaixo:

* **Acesse o cadastro do produto**
  * No menu lateral, clique em **Catálogo** > **Produtos**.
  * Clique em **Novo produto** e preencha as informações básicas: **nome**, **imagem**, **descrição** e demais campos necessários.
* **Defina o preço de venda zerado**
  * No campo **Preço de venda**, informe **R$ 0,00**.
  * Isso é importante, pois os valores reais serão definidos através dos **complementos**.
  * Clique em **Salvar** para continuar.

<figure><img src="/files/hlkwHOOnpxQfqwXQgTVw" alt=""><figcaption></figcaption></figure>

{% hint style="info" %}
**Atenção:** o valor do produto deve permanecer zerado, pois o preço será definido nas opções de escolha dentro do complemento.
{% endhint %}

* **Crie o complemento do produto**
  * Após salvar, você será direcionado para a tela de **Complementos**.
  * Clique em **Adicionar um complemento**.
  * No campo de pesquisa, digite o nome do complemento desejado e clique no botão verde **Novo complemento**.

<figure><img src="/files/8uD93VSnnUhMiqd1blcF" alt=""><figcaption></figcaption></figure>

* **Configure as opções do complemento**
  * Na tela do complemento, clique em **Adicionar opções** para criar as diferentes variações.
  * Preencha cada opção com **nome** e **preço de venda** correspondente.

<figure><img src="/files/3TWCdqpOiqgpZEktcIuU" alt=""><figcaption></figcaption></figure>

* **Defina as regras de escolha**
  * Logo abaixo, em **O cliente poderá escolher**, você terá três opções:
    * **Apenas uma das opções**
    * **Mais de uma opção sem repetição**
    * **Mais de uma opção com repetição**
  * Para tornar a escolha obrigatória:
    * Se escolher **Apenas uma das opções**, habilite a opção **O cliente obrigatoriamente precisa escolher uma das opções**.
    * Se escolher **Mais de uma opção**, defina no primeiro campo o **mínimo de opções obrigatórias** (ex.: 1) e no segundo campo o **máximo permitido**.

<p align="center"><img src="/files/zK7yk5Ks1zPH49Vn80ll" alt=""><img src="/files/mNwoduCOHbO0i89gA7sd" alt=""></p>

* **Finalize o cadastro**
  * Após configurar todas as opções, preços e obrigatoriedades, clique em **Salvar**.

Pronto! Agora o produto ficará disponível com preço **"a partir de"**, e o valor final será definido conforme a escolha do cliente nas opções criadas.

<p align="center"><img src="/files/39NsavMbjeZpMz9TCXBr" alt=""> <img src="/files/F5mxUJlBBQyytV3U8saB" alt=""></p>


---

# Agent Instructions
This documentation is published with GitBook. GitBook is the documentation platform designed so that both humans and AI agents can read, navigate, and reason over technical content effectively. Learn more at gitbook.com.

## Querying This Documentation
If you need additional information that is not directly available in this page, you can query the documentation dynamically by asking a question.

Perform an HTTP GET request on the current page URL with the `ask` query parameter, and the optional `goal` query parameter:

```
GET https://ajuda.cardapioweb.com/gestao/catalogo/como-criar-um-produto-e-uma-categoria/como-criar-um-produto-com-variacoes-de-valores-a-partir-de.md?ask=<question>&goal=<endgoal>
```

`ask` is the immediate question: it should be specific, self-contained, and written in natural language.
`goal` is optional and describes the broader end goal you are ultimately trying to accomplish on behalf of the user. GitBook uses it to tailor the answer towards what is most useful for that goal.

The response will contain a direct answer to the question and relevant excerpts and sources from the documentation.

Use this mechanism when the answer is not explicitly present in the current page, you need clarification or additional context, or you want to retrieve related documentation sections.
